Day 4: Journey to Abu Simbel - See the Majestic Temples
After breakfast, check out of your hotel and embark on a journey to the incredible Abu Simbel Temples, a highlight of the Cairo to Abu Simbel Tour. These monumental temples, carved out of solid rock, were built by Pharaoh Ramses II and are dedicated to the gods Ptah, Re-Her-Akhtey, Amun-Re, and Ramses himself. Learn about the temples’ fascinating history and how they were relocated to their current site to save them from the rising waters of Lake Nasser. When is the best time to visit Cairo and Abu Simbel?
The ideal time to tour Cairo and Abu Simbel is between October and April, when the weather is cooler, making sightseeing at both the pyramids and the temples more comfortable.
